%I A005584 M2059
%S A005584 2,13,49,140,336,714,1386,2508,4290,7007,11011,16744,24752,35700,50388,
%T A005584 69768,94962,127281,168245,219604,283360,361790,457470,573300,712530,
%U A005584 878787,1076103,1308944,1582240,1901416
%N A005584 Coefficients of Chebyshev polynomials.
%C A005584 If X is an n-set and Y a fixed 2-subset of X then a(n-6) is equal to 
               the number of (n-6)-subsets of X intersecting Y. - Milan R. Janjic 
               (agnus(AT)blic.net), Jul 30 2007

%F A005584 G.f.: (2 - x) / ( 1 - x )^7.
%F A005584 a(n)=binomial(n+5, n-1)+binomial(n+4, n-1)=1/720*n*(n+11)*(n+4)*(n+3)*(n+2)*(n+1).
%F A005584 Binomial(n,6)+2*binomial(n,5), n>=5. - Zerinvary Lajos (zerinvarylajos(AT)yahoo.com), 
               Jul 26 2006
%p A005584 [seq(binomial(n,6)+2*binomial(n,5), n=5..35)]; - Zerinvary Lajos (zerinvarylajos(AT)yahoo.com), 
               Jul 26 2006
%p A005584 A005584:=(-2+z)/(z-1)**7; [S. Plouffe in his 1992 dissertation.]
